Reliable Timekeeping Solutions: Anti-Ligature Clock Enclosures

In settings where safety and security are paramount, ensuring accurate timekeeping while mitigating risks is crucial. Anti-ligature clock enclosures provide a robust approach to address these concerns. These specialized enclosures are designed with tamper-resistant materials and construction to prevent unauthorized tampering with the clock mechanism. By eliminating potential ligature points, anti-ligature clock enclosures help prevent the risk of self-harm or assaults.

The casing is typically made from durable materials such as stainless steel or high-impact plastic. It features a secure locking mechanism and often includes additional protective features like tamper-evident seals or hidden areas. Moreover, the clock face itself may be recessed or protected to prevent tampering.

Preventing Ligature Risks: Specialized Anti-Ligature Clocks

Within high-risk locations, ensuring patient safety is paramount. Critical factor in suicide prevention involves eliminating potential ligature points. Standard clocks often pose a risk, as their cords and hands can be used for self-harm. To mitigate this threat, specialized anti-ligature clocks have emerged.

Such clocks feature unique mechanisms that remove or significantly change potential ligature points. For example, they may incorporate solid, non-removable hands, shatterproof lenses, and concealed power connections. By replacing conventional clocks with anti-ligature alternatives, organizations can proactively minimize the risk of ligature cases.

  • Additionally, some anti-ligature clocks are equipped with further safety features. This may include tamper-proof casings, integrated alarms, or even the ability to remotely monitor time and humidity.

Protecting Well-Being with Anti-Ligature Clocks

In residential care centers, patient safety is paramount. A significant concern is the risk of self-harm, which can be exacerbated by accessible objects like traditional clocks with protruding hands or cords. To address this challenge, innovative anti-ligature clock technology has emerged as a vital solution. These specialized clocks are designed to eliminate potential ligature points, providing a safer and more secure environment for vulnerable individuals.

  • Constructed from durable materials, anti-ligature clocks often feature flush surfaces, recessed dials, and non-removable components.
  • They are specifically built to withstand tampering attempts and resist manipulation by individuals at risk.
